Academy teams and instructors

Publish courses with the access model learners need.

Every academy can expose a branded catalog, sell a course, let learners self-enroll, or keep a course private and share it by invitation. Visibility controls discovery; enrollment mode controls how access is granted.

Choose discovery and enrollment separately

SettingUse it whenLearner outcome
academy_publicThe course belongs in the academy storefront.Its catalog and detail page can be discovered through the academy URL.
privateAccess is controlled by staff or invitations.The course never appears in public catalog results.
self_enrollA public free course can be joined directly.The learner receives an active enrollment and is sent to learning.
checkoutA public paid course requires payment.The learner is sent to the existing invoice and payment flow.
invite_onlyA private or cohort-style course needs controlled access.Staff enrollment or a valid invitation grants access.
Configure course accessSet visibility and enrollment mode in Course Studio → Landing Page → Marketplace.
Publish with readinessUse the Publish tab to review storefront eligibility and access state.
Grant accessSelf-enroll, checkout, invitation acceptance, or staff enrollment creates the course relationship.
Start learningAccess sends the learner to the protected course player, never directly to private curriculum.

Academy storefront

Academy storefronts are scoped to one active academy. The catalog supports search and course filters; course detail pages show outcomes, instructor identity, availability, pricing, related courses, and the learner’s current access state. A public course route is not a bypass for protected lesson content.

Named routePublic behavior
academy.storefront.indexLists published storefront-visible courses for an academy.
academy.storefront.showShows one published storefront-visible course.
academy.storefront.enrollAuthenticated entry point that self-enrolls or starts checkout after access-policy checks.

Private invitations and staff enrollment

Invitation rules
  • Create invitations in Course Studio → Publish for a course you are allowed to manage.
  • Invitations are addressed to one email, can expire, and can only be accepted by that matching account.
  • Acceptance creates an enrollment with invitation access source and opens the learner’s course player.
Staff enrollment
  • Enrollment operations remain available to authorized academy staff.
  • Use staff enrollment when access should not depend on an email acceptance step.
  • Keep staff enrollment, invitation creation, and academy visibility inside the correct academy scope.
Operational rule: change a course’s marketplace settings before publishing. Do not use public visibility as a substitute for preview content; public lesson previews remain governed by the existing lesson protection rules.
